Canada Embassy FAQs

  • Can the Canada embassy assist in legal issues abroad?
    Yes, the Canada embassy can provide guidance and resources for legal issues abroad, including information on local legal services and how to navigate the legal system in Uzbekistan.

  • What should I do if I lose my Canada passport in Uzbekistan?
    If you lose your passport in Uzbekistan, report the loss to local authorities and then contact the Canada embassy for assistance with obtaining a replacement passport.

  • Does the Canada embassy provide notarial services?
    Yes, the Canada embassy offers notarial services, such as witnessing signatures and certifying documents.

  • How can I stay informed about travel advisories for Uzbekistan?
    You can stay informed about travel advisories by visiting the Government of Canada’s travel advisory website or subscribing to updates from the Canada embassy.

  • What help can the Canada embassy offer in case of wrongful detention?
    The Canada embassy can provide assistance and support, including contacting local legal representatives and providing information about legal rights.

Summarized Diplomatic Presence

Canada maintains a diplomatic presence in Uzbekistan primarily through its embassy located in the capital city, Tashkent. The embassy plays a pivotal role in fostering bilateral relations by facilitating political dialogue, promoting trade, and enhancing cooperation on various international issues, including security and human rights. By providing essential services to Canadians and engaging with the Uzbek government, the embassy helps strengthen the ties between the two nations, showcasing the importance of international collaboration and support.
